Transaction 5458a26e38fb5e348543b8f12e52b14ce508086d864aa4191d793efdfaf8641d

1 Input
2 Outputs
  • 5458a26e38fb5e348543b8f12e52b14ce508086d864aa4191d793efdfaf8641d:0
  • value  262944669
    address  3CrFvWY6a3zTWBWVNNx5yKrzbS3XqGeRfV
  • 5458a26e38fb5e348543b8f12e52b14ce508086d864aa4191d793efdfaf8641d:1
  • value  123826
    address  17CNp1XAWCnq8Cwdp42nATHt65bQ22vgHS